Mahanagar Gas Ltd
Glance View

In the bustling metropolis of Mumbai, where the pulse of the city beats to the rhythm of relentless activity, Mahanagar Gas Ltd. (MGL) stands as a vital artery in its complex infrastructure. Established in 1995, MGL has carved its niche by providing a cleaner, more efficient alternative to traditional fossil fuels through its extensive network of piped natural gas (PNG) and compressed natural gas (CNG) distribution. The company harnesses the synergy of natural gas to fuel households and industries while powering the city's vast fleet of public and private transportation. This seamless integration not only underscores its commitment to sustainability but also positions it as a crucial player in urban energy management by transforming environmental challenges into profitable business avenues. At the core of MGL's success is its sophisticated business model, which thrives on a robust and efficient distribution system. With strategic pipelines snaking through urban landscapes and state-of-the-art CNG stations strategically placed, MGL taps into a steady stream of revenues. Residential users form one pillar of this economic structure, subscribing to the convenience of PNG, eliminating the hassles associated with traditional fuel procurement. On the other hand, the transportation segment, with an ever-increasing demand for green fuel, drives growth through CNG sales. By leveraging India's burgeoning shift towards cleaner energy sources, MGL ensures a stable cash flow, balancing profitability with its mission to contribute to a greener future for one of the world's most dynamic cities.

What is Net Margin?
Net Margin shows how much profit a company keeps from each dollar of sales after all expenses, including taxes and interest. It reflects the company`s overall profitability.
How is Net Margin calculated?

Net Margin is calculated by dividing the Net Income by the Revenue.

What is Mahanagar Gas Ltd's current Net Margin?

The current Net Margin for Mahanagar Gas Ltd is 11.2%, which is below its 3-year median of 14.7%.

How has Net Margin changed over time?

Over the last 3 years, Mahanagar Gas Ltd’s Net Margin has increased from 9.6% to 11.2%. During this period, it reached a low of 9.6% on Sep 30, 2022 and a high of 18.7% on Dec 31, 2023.
